| +// Copyright 2015 The Chromium Authors. All rights reserved.
|
| +// Use of this source code is governed by a BSD-style license that can be
|
| +// found in the LICENSE file.
|
| +
|
| +#ifndef CONTENT_RENDERER_NAVIGATION_STATE_IMPL_H_
|
| +#define CONTENT_RENDERER_NAVIGATION_STATE_IMPL_H_
|
| +
|
| +#include <string>
|
| +
|
| +#include "content/common/navigation_params.h"
|
| +#include "content/public/renderer/navigation_state.h"
|
| +
|
| +namespace content {
|
| +
|
| +class CONTENT_EXPORT NavigationStateImpl : public NavigationState {
|
| + public:
|
| + ~NavigationStateImpl() override;
|
| +
|
| + static NavigationStateImpl* CreateBrowserInitiated(
|
| + const CommonNavigationParams& common_params,
|
| + const StartNavigationParams& start_params,
|
| + const HistoryNavigationParams& history_params);
|
| +
|
| + static NavigationStateImpl* CreateContentInitiated();
|
| +
|
| + // NavigationState implementation.
|
| + ui::PageTransition GetTransitionType() override;
|
| + bool WasWithinSamePage() override;
|
| + bool IsContentInitiated() override;
|
| +
|
| + const CommonNavigationParams& common_params() const { return common_params_; }
|
| + const StartNavigationParams& start_params() const { return start_params_; }
|
| + const HistoryNavigationParams& history_params() const {
|
| + return history_params_;
|
| + }
|
| + bool request_committed() const { return request_committed_; }
|
| + void set_request_committed(bool value) { request_committed_ = value; }
|
| + void set_was_within_same_page(bool value) { was_within_same_page_ = value; }
|
| +
|
| + void set_transition_type(ui::PageTransition transition) {
|
| + common_params_.transition = transition;
|
| + }
|
| +
|
| + private:
|
| + NavigationStateImpl(const CommonNavigationParams& common_params,
|
| + const StartNavigationParams& start_params,
|
| + const HistoryNavigationParams& history_params,
|
| + bool is_content_initiated);
|
| +
|
| + bool request_committed_;
|
| + bool was_within_same_page_;
|
| +
|
| + // True if this navigation was not initiated via WebFrame::LoadRequest.
|
| + const bool is_content_initiated_;
|
| +
|
| + CommonNavigationParams common_params_;
|
| + const StartNavigationParams start_params_;
|
| +
|
| + // Note: if IsContentInitiated() is false, whether this navigation should
|
| + // replace the current entry in the back/forward history list is determined by
|
| + // the should_replace_current_entry field in |history_params|. Otherwise, use
|
| + // replacesCurrentHistoryItem() on the WebDataSource.
|
| + //
|
| + // TODO(davidben): It would be good to unify these and have only one source
|
| + // for the two cases. We can plumb this through WebFrame::loadRequest to set
|
| + // lockBackForwardList on the FrameLoadRequest. However, this breaks process
|
| + // swaps because FrameLoader::loadWithNavigationAction treats loads before a
|
| + // FrameLoader has committedFirstRealDocumentLoad as a replacement. (Added for
|
| + // http://crbug.com/178380).
|
| + const HistoryNavigationParams history_params_;
|
| +
|
| + DISALLOW_COPY_AND_ASSIGN(NavigationStateImpl);
|
| +};
|
| +
|
| +} // namespace content
|
| +
|
| +#endif // CONTENT_RENDERER_NAVIGATION_STATE_IMPL_H_
